The Science of Sleep, Stress, Weight Loss, and Longevity with Shawn Stevenson

Shawn Stevenson explains why sleep, stress, relationships, and food quality are the most critical factors for health and longevity, often outweighing the latest wellness trends.

Basic health factors like sleep, stress management, relationships, and food quality are often more impactful on health and longevity than advanced biohacking tools or supplements.

Key takeaways

What to know before you press play.

01

Sleep Is a Foundational Health Factor

Sleep was identified as a missing factor for clients who were doing everything right but not seeing results, highlighting its critical role in overall health optimization.

6
02

Relationships Drive Longevity

Relationships may be the number one factor in longevity, serving as an underrated hack for extending life and improving well-being.

11
03

Food Quality Influences Body Composition

While calories matter, food quality changes what the body does with them, influencing whether weight loss results in muscle or fat loss.

13
04

Morning Exercise Resets Cortisol

Morning exercise can help reset the cortisol rhythm, which in turn improves sleep quality and overall stress management.

7
05

Melatonin Misconceptions

There are common misunderstandings about melatonin, and taking more of it is not always better for sleep quality.

About the Guest

Shawn Stevenson's Background

Shawn Stevenson is the host of The Model Health Show, one of the top-rated health podcasts. He is the author of the international bestseller Sleep Smarter, translated into more than 20 languages, as well as Eat Smarter and the Eat Smarter Family Cookbook.
